As you consider options, don't hesitate to reach out and schedule a visit. A phone call or a tour is the best way to get a true feel for the environment. When you visit, pay attention to the warmth of the teachers and the atmosphere of the classroom. Is it a place where play is valued as the primary work of childhood? Look for spaces dedicated to building, creating, reading, and pretend play. Ask about the daily schedule; a quality part-time program will have a predictable flow that might include circle time, free play, a simple snack, storytime, and outdoor recess, all within a short, two-to-three-hour window that feels just right for young attention spans.
